ByteDance logo
字节跳动
高级前端开发工程师-AI应用与创新

高级前端开发工程师-AI应用与创新

发布于 1 天前

普通员工/个人贡献者

深圳市
高级经验
全职员工
仅现场办公
本科
软件工程
性能优化
AI应用
前端工程化

AI 估算 · 25k–45k

字节跳动高级前端,深圳互联网大厂,技术栈主流,薪资竞争力强,大致范围25k-45k。

职位详情

关于这个职位

作为字节跳动AI应用与创新团队的高级前端开发工程师,你将负责公司级工程效率平台的开发与优化,包括客服数据中心、蓝军平台等核心系统

你需要深度参与前端工程化体系建设,用技术驱动业务发展,同时探索前沿技术并赋能团队
这是一个兼具深度与广度的高价值技术岗位

最低要求

本科及以上学历,计算机相关专业优先

扎实的计算机基础知识,熟悉常用的数据结构、算法和设计模式,并能在日常研发中灵活使用
熟练掌握HTML、CSS、JavaScript等Web开发技术,至少熟悉前端主流框架如React、Vue、Angular之一,并有实际项目研发经验
熟悉Webpack等构建工具,熟悉模块化、前端编译原理
熟悉网站性能优化,了解浏览器实现原理
能够独立完成一个复杂模块或项目的研发工作
具备较强的责任感、团队合作精神、逻辑思维能力和表达能力

工作职责

负责公司级工程效率平台的开发工作,包括并不限于客服数据中心、蓝军平台、抖音基础体验平台以及影像工程效率平台的前端开发与优化工作

参与团队前端工程化体系建设,逐步提升研发效率、研发质量,通过前端技术的不断产出驱动业务的发展
负责核心Feature系统研发以及规划,落地到业务产生收益,不断优化用户体验
关注前端前沿技术发展,能够将新知识传递给团队,并且转化到潜在项目中

优先资格

具备多端(Web/Native)开发能力,有Node.js、Go、Python等后端Web服务开发经验

了解React Native、Flutter、小程序等,有一定的实际开发经验
对于Mv*框架源码有一定的研究
有开源作品或者技术博客

AI 洞察

优缺点分析

优点

  • 专注于AI应用与创新,处于技术前沿,有机会探索和实践最新前端技术
  • 团队内部技术氛围浓厚,有开源和技术分享文化,利于个人品牌建设
  • 薪资福利具有竞争力,股票期权等长期激励
  • 工作强度较大,互联网大厂节奏快,可能需要应对紧急需求和加班
  • 适合有3-5年以上前端经验、追求技术深度和广度、能适应高强度工作、希望在大型平台实现技术突破的工程师

缺点 / 挑战

  • 加入字节跳动这样的大型互联网平台,接触亿级用户场景,技术挑战大,成长快
  • 前端技术栈更新迅速,需要持续学习保持技术竞争力,压力较大
  • 涉及多平台和多业务线,沟通协调成本较高,需要较强的跨团队协作能力

角色解读

  • 技术深度方向:成为前端架构师或技术专家,深入浏览器内核、编译原理、性能优化等领域
  • 管理方向:可发展为技术主管或前端团队负责人,带领团队进行技术规划与项目管理
  • 跨界发展:结合后端知识(Node.js/Go/Python)转型为全栈工程师或解决方案架构师
  • 负责工程效率平台的前端开发与优化,包括客服数据中心、蓝军平台等核心系统
  • 参与前端工程化体系建设,提升研发效率和质量,通过技术输出驱动业务增长
  • 负责核心Feature系统的研发与规划,持续优化用户体验并产生业务收益
  • 关注前沿前端技术,将新技术引入团队并落地到实际项目中
  • 扎实的计算机基础,熟练掌握数据结构、算法和设计模式
  • 精通HTML、CSS、JavaScript,至少精通React/Vue/Angular之一并有实际项目经验
  • 熟悉Webpack等构建工具及前端编译原理,了解浏览器渲染机制和性能优化
  • 具备独立承担复杂模块研发的能力,良好的团队合作与沟通能力

申请策略

  • 了解字节跳动AI应用与创新部门的产品方向,在面试中展示对业务的理解和兴趣
  • 准备1-2个自己主导的架构设计或优化案例,用STAR原则清晰讲述过程与结果
  • 突出前端框架(React/Vue/Angular)的深度项目经验,特别是复杂模块或性能优化案例
  • 强调工程化实践,如Webpack配置优化、CI/CD集成、前端监控等
  • 展示对浏览器原理、性能优化、跨端开发等领域的理解,通过具体数据证明成果
  • 如果有开源项目或技术博客,务必列出,体现技术影响力
  • 若未掌握React Native/Flutter等跨端技术,可提前学习并做简单demo
  • 可补充一些后端知识,如Node.js、Go或Python,以应对多端开发需求

面试指南

  • 项目类问题:用STAR法则(情境-任务-行动-结果),突出难点、决策过程和量化收益
  • 原理类问题:先给出核心概念定义,然后分步骤说明执行过程,最后点出优缺点
  • 优化类问题:先说明问题现象和诊断工具,然后针对不同层面(网络/渲染/代码)给出具体措施,最后用数据对比展示优化效果
  • 请描述一个你负责过的复杂前端项目,如何设计架构并解决性能问题?
  • React的Fiber架构了解吗?它的实现原理和传统diff算法有什么区别?
  • 如何优化一个加载缓慢的页面?请从网络、渲染、代码层面给出方案
  • Webpack的打包原理是什么?如何优化构建速度?
  • 你有什么开源作品或技术文章?分享一个你最有成就的技术输出

职位点评

70
综合评分

字节大厂,高级前端岗位,技术前沿,薪资优厚,但工作强度大,WLB一般。

更适合这类人
适合追求技术成长、薪资回报、能接受高强度工作节奏的求职者。
表现最好
成长发展
相对薄弱
工作生活
薪资福利82
成长发展88
工作生活45
使命价值65

薪资福利

82较高

字节跳动提供具有竞争力的薪资和福利,但JD未明确列出,参考大厂水平,薪资信号偏高。

薪资信号市场水准 (25K-45K/月)

成长发展

88较高

职位涉及AI应用创新和工程效率平台,技术栈主流且前沿,有大量成长空间,JD明确要求关注前沿技术并传递团队。

技术前沿前沿/新兴技术
技术栈React、Vue、Angular、Webpack、Node.js、性能优化、前端工程化、AI应用
成长机会关注前端前沿技术发展、将新知识传递给团队
业务类型ambiguous

工作生活

45较低

大厂通常工作强度较高,但JD未明确WLB,且地点为深圳科技园,通勤压力大。

工作模式仅现场办公
办公地点科技园/产业园
加班情况未提及(无法判断)

使命价值

65中等

职位服务于工程效率,间接推动业务,但直接社会价值不明显,属于中性。

行业发展高速增长赛道
社会影响中性/一般
创新程度积极采用新技术
Watch Jobs